New printer

Early last year it became evident our printer was no longer going to work for us and we set out to find a new one. We seriously looked at laser printers for a while but then found an Epson printer that uses eco tanks instead of the standard cartridges and that kind of won us over. We bought that at great expense and brought it home to set up.

The first thing we found was it was a lot harder than our earlier Canon printers. It took a while to get it set up so we could print from various locations. It was also noted early on that it wasn’t compatible with Airprint and some of the other more current applications for printing. I was a bit bugged by that…but I thought if it does the job, it will be fine.

I won’t go into much detail but we soon realised we both hated that printer. We really wanted to replace it but it was a bit hard to do when we’d spent so much on the purchase. Well, over a year post-printer purchase we started rethinking the idea of a laser printer.

After quite a bit of research it was narrowed down to a Brother printer and then further down to a laser color printer when one of the local stores had a sale via ebay.

It’s quite a big machine but so far I just love it. Printing and scanning are so much easier. I haven’t had to spend nearly as much time sorting things out just so I can use it. On top of that, the ink won’t dry out and since we really don’t print too often this could well last us ten years or more. Plus it has a feed for scanning documents for those times when we need it. Much easier than going back and forth.
